Output e0876ebb284a920aece3e00553a0e2558726c671049c9f331d7daa7046970730:1

value
3780679319
script pubkey
OP_0 OP_PUSHBYTES_20 2b5e161622a18c3e7695b3013b2a9def5222a936
address
tb1q9d0pv93z5xxrua54kvqnk25aaafz92fkkjx77r
transaction
e0876ebb284a920aece3e00553a0e2558726c671049c9f331d7daa7046970730